I also thought you can't parallel them, but you can. I spoke to several people that actually did it. They said the hard part is IGBTs have a "negative temperature coefficient", so are subject to thermal runaway. You can be careful to keep them cool, and watch their temperature closely, and safely parallel them, it's just harder than mosfets. Mosfets tend to balance themselves in parallel because the ones that get more current increase their RdsON, lowering their current draw.
